Play on multiple levels

To bring relief to your garden, you can arrange it by playing on different levels. For example, you can create tubs to raise beds. They will also be more practical to maintain since you will not have to bend down. They will also be better exposed to light.

It is also possible to install terraces to create different spaces. You can choose to access it by a small wooden or stone staircase, for example. Dividing a garden gives the impression of taking advantage of a denser space.

Enhance your fence

The fence of a garden in the city is often a little too present. We must therefore seek to eliminate this limit. It can be concealed by plants. In some cases this is not possible, then you can try to put it forward, that is, treat it as a decorative element in its own right. Several solutions are available to you :

  • You can paint it in a bright color.
  • You can build a beautiful wooden fence to provide warmth through this natural material.
  • You can turn it into a green wall.

If you have a large wall that can be a bit oppressive, you can paint it a dark color, black for example, and make a sort of picture with wood siding on it. This very simple solution makes it possible to break the size of the wall. The possibilities are endless and will depend on your budget, but also on the style you want for your garden.

Focus on harmony

In your garden it is important to create a harmonious space. This is why it is important to choose the colors that you are going to invite in this place to give an overall impression.

In the same way, also avoid multiplying different materials. This means that you shouldn’t go beyond two or three different types so as not to create visual overload and keep some consistency.

Optimize space

Just because you own a city garden doesn’t mean you can’t put everything you want. To do this, it is important to optimize the space. For example, tubs for plantations can integrate benches to allow you to settle there.

You can also choose furniture that incorporates storage. It is also possible to install a children’s corner. For example, you can integrate a sandbox on the terrace.

Don’t forget the lighting

Whatever your garden, it is important not to forget the lighting. Not only is it a decorative element, but it also allows you to move around safely outside. There are very aesthetic lighting systems, you can choose them according to the style you have chosen for your exterior. Remember to put it in different places to allow you to reach from one place to another easily.

In addition, in fine weather, they will allow you to enjoy your outdoors later in the evening. Choose their location carefully to highlight certain elements or plants, for example.

Persistent plants

When choosing your plants, choose those with persistent foliage. This way your garden will remain attractive all year round. Indeed, in autumn and winter, gardens tend to be sadder and lose their interest. Some ideas :

  • By focusing on evergreen plants, even in the bad season, your garden remains beautiful. Ideally, two-thirds of your plants should be evergreen.
  • You can also select your plants so that the blooms follow one another. Thus, you can install a hedge where the different shrubs bloom one after the other or offer superb fall foliage. In this way, your garden benefits from a renewal season after season.
  • To create scent spaces, you can also bet on plants offering flowering with a pleasant scent.

A swimming pool or a pond

Right now there are so many solutions that no matter how much space you have, it is possible to install a water point in your garden. According to your desires, you have several possibilities:

  • You can bet on a basin. It can accommodate vegetation and you can accommodate some fish.
  • If you prefer a more minimalist look, you can simply install a water point. You will enjoy the freshness that this basin brings.
  • If you like the sound of water, a fountain will delight you.
  • If your preferences turn to swimming pool, again you will have the choice. In a small garden, it is possible to conceal the swimming pool under a terrace to conserve all the space, but also to protect your swimming pool when it is not in use and to protect yourself from vis-à-vis. It is also possible to opt for a semi-inground swimming pool which will help to give relief to your garden, etc.

Lines or curves

Again, it’s a matter of taste.

  • If you opt for a very linear layout, you will then create square or rectangular spaces. This solution is the most widespread. However, in this case, it is better not to trim the hedges too geometrically, as this may give the impression of a small space. Instead, leave the vegetation a little free, this will add charm to your garden and you can enjoy a green space so rare in the city.
  • However, you can choose to break this linear aspect. by betting on curves. This solution will make it possible to fight against the rigidity of the ground and, at the same time, to forget the limits of the ground.

Bring shade

Do not forget to arrange shaded spaces to enjoy a little coolness in the heart of summer. It may be thanks to the vegetation, but in this case, you will have to wait until it is large enough. You can also install shade sails, a parasol, etc. All these solutions will also protect you from vis-à-vis, at the same time.

Facilitate circulation

After choosing your plants, you must install them so that you can move around freely. Do not hesitate to develop paths. It can be with Japanese steps, cobblestones, etc. You will then take advantage of all the space. The lawn is not compulsory and has the disadvantage of requiring some maintenance. Indeed, it must then be mowed, or to mow, you need a mower and a place to store it. Sometimes, therefore, it is better to opt for other types of ground cover.
